The TLF35584 offers wide frequency range for efficiency and small filters. It has a dedicated reference regulator for ADC and sensor supplies. Its flexible features suit numerous applications. It supports ASIL-D with Microcontrollers (μCs). Available in small VQFN-48 package. Contact sales or TAC for details. Featured on Hitex ShieldBuddy AURIX™ TC375.

Description

  • Extended lifetime in a leadless and smaller package
  • Efficiency and flexibility
  • Enables ASIL-D on system level
  • Easy ISO26262 implementation by full documentation set
  • Extended Lifetime

    • Enable target Grade 0, up to 1000h HTOL at Tj = 175°C
    • Capability to go beyond Grade 0
  • Pre-/post-regulator concept: boost and buck/LDOs and trackers for

    • μC (main, ADC/reference, StBy)
    • Transceivers
    • Sensors
  • Integration of functional safety (features supporting ASIL-D)

    • UV/OV-monitoring
    • Flexible watchdogs
    • Error-monitoring
    • Safe state controller with 2 outputs
    • BIST
